The Littelfuse 3.0SMCJ Series is designed specifically to protect sensitive electronic equipment from voltage transients induced by lightning and other transient voltage events.
3000W PPPM peak pulse power capability at 10/1000μs waveform, repetition rate (duty cycles): 0.01%
For surface mounted applications in order to optimize board space
Low profile package
Typical failure mode is short from over-specified voltage or current
Whisker test is conducted based on JEDEC JESD201A per its table 4a and 4c
ESD protection of data lines in accordance with IEC 61000-4-2,30kV(Air), 30kV (Contact)
EFT protection of data lines in accordance with IEC 61000- 4-4
Built-in strain relief
Glass passivated chip junction
Fast response time: typically less than 1.0ps from 0V to BV min
Excellent clamping capability
Low incremental surge resistance
High temperature to reflow soldering guaranteed: 260°C/40sec
